A Grandchild’s Greed

Daniel’s eyes sparkled with barely concealed excitement. “Of course, Mom. We can take care of that for you,” he said smoothly, eager to gain control of my finances. Paula exchanged a knowing glance with him—a silent pact passing between them.

Playing the Part

Over the next few weeks, I played my role flawlessly. I misplaced my glasses, forgot familiar recipes, and occasionally called my grandson by my late husband’s name. Each act of “forgetfulness” earned patronizing reassurances and smug smiles. They believed it was only a matter of time before I surrendered my empire.

Meanwhile, I observed quietly, slipping a small voice recorder into my cardigan pocket. I captured their careless conversations about new homes, vacations, and plans for life without me. Each cruel comment became evidence, a step closer to exposing their greed.

The Final Test

The day arrived. We sat in the lawyer’s office, tension thick in the air. Daniel and Paula watched expectantly as I hesitated over the power of attorney documents. My hand trembled over the paper, and I glanced at them, feigning resignation.

“Mom, we’ll take care of everything,” Paula said softly, sweetness masking intent. Kyle sat nearby, boredom etched across his face.

I nodded slowly and signed, appearing weak. But they didn’t know the truth. I had already transferred the bulk of my assets into an irrevocable trust managed by a trusted confidant. The documents before them were a ruse, a final test of their greed.

The Collapse

It didn’t take long for them to discover the accounts were empty. Fury erupted, betrayal complete. They even called the police, perhaps hoping for an accident that would leave them as sole heirs.

But I had left evidence behind—a detailed dossier of their plans, recorded conversations, and proof of neglect and manipulation. The image of a helpless old woman they had crafted crumbled completely.

The police arrived, not to remove me, but to take statements against Daniel and Paula for attempted manipulation and elder abuse. Their scheme collapsed like a house of cards, leaving them facing legal consequences beyond their worst fears.

Strength Restored

In the aftermath, I remained the determined woman who had built an empire with my husband. I had learned the value of vigilance and standing firm, even when the enemy is your own blood. My legacy remained intact—a testament to resilience, strength, and the folly of underestimating me.
